Works for Me Wednesday: Fisher Price-a-palooza



We don't have a playroom in our house. Our playroom is the room we also like to more commonly call "the living room." This means that at various times of the day, we clean everything up before people drag stuff into the living room again. Otherwise though, the toys all live in kids' bedrooms.


Every so often, I like to have what I think of as a Fisher Price-a-palooza. We have spent lots of money (or other people have through gifts) on all kinds of Fisher Price playsets and people. So, sometimes I pull out our couple of buckets of FP people, vehicles, etc and plop them down right in the middle of the living room. And, then I line the living room with different playsets (the house, the farm, the zoo, the old 1974 castle, the big Discovery City with the roadway that moves in a circle, and so on), and I just don't worry about how it looks in the living room for the day.


Something about having it all out just inspires all the kids to get down and do a lot of pretend play. And, sure -- some of the kids play with it longer than others. The almost eight year old plays for only a short time, while the two year old is at it much longer. But, still -- everyone has fun and it makes for a different and interesting day. And, really -- this tip could carry over to just about any kinds of themed playsets.
